@charset "UTF-8";
/* ################################################################
** # "YAML for TYPO3" (c) by You if you put something in here :) ##
** ################################################################
**
**  Date     : 23.8.07
**  File     : myOwnStyles.css
**  Function : This file is not part of the YAML-CSS-Framework.
**             It was included to give the user the possibility to quickly apply tests, changes or
**             whatever with no need to change the YAML-files and mess up anything.
**             Hmmm. Does this make sense? Anyway, use it or just leave it empty. It will do no harm.
**             This is the last stylesheet beeing imported. So, everything can be overwritten here.
**             Be careful what you put in here and don't hold us responsible for anything that goes wrong...
*/
@media all
{
/* Your styles here */

body {background:#eee; padding-top:10px;}
#page{border:none;}

#header {position:relative; height:140px; color:#fff; background:none;}
#header img {position:absolute; top:0px; left:5px; font-size:208%;}
#header .headImg2 {margin-top:10px; margin-left:15px; }

#header div.tx-macinasearchbox-pi1 {position:absolute; top:117px; right:10px; font-size:11px;}
#header div.tx-macinasearchbox-pi1 input {margin-left:0;}
#header div.tx-macinasearchbox-pi1 form span {display:block; font-weight:bold; color:#aaa;}
#header div.tx-macinasearchbox-pi1 form input {width:170px; height:13px;}
#topnav {top:95px; font-size:13px; color:#669;}

#topnav a {color:#669;}

#teaser {margin:0; padding:0; background:#fff; color:#765; border-bottom: 1px solid;}

.adresse { position: absolute; top:8px; left: 475px; font-size:13px; color: #669; width: 550px;}
.adresse .strong {font-size:15px; font-weight: bolder;}
.adresse .mail img {margin-left: 293px; margin-top: 58px;}

  /* Level 1 */
  #submenu li#active,
  #submenu li strong {
    width: 90%;
    padding: 1px 0px 1px 10%;
    font-weight: bold;
    color: #fff;
    background-color:#AA1124;
    border-bottom: 1px #eee solid;
  }

/* Formatierung der Fuýzeile */
#footer {color:#888; background:#fff; margin:0em; padding:0.5em 1em 0.5em 0; border-top:1px #ddd solid; line-height:1em; text-align: right;}
#footer img { vertical-align: middle; margin-left:10px;}

/* ######################################################################################################
** ### Formatierung der Inhaltsspalten ##################################################################
** ######################################################################################################
*/

p { text-align: justify; }
li {margin: 10px; }

/* ######################################################################################################
** ### Formatierung LOOK & BOOK #########################################################################
** ######################################################################################################
*/

.lub_legende a, #ziel_link {white-space: nowrap;}
.right {float:right;}
.left {float:left;}
.labBacklink {text-align: right;}

/*### Address ###############
*/

.url_hits {white-space: nowrap;}
span.bezeichnung {color: #222222; font-weight:normal; margin-left: 1.5em; display:block; overflow: auto;}
div.labbezeichnung {color: #222222; font-weight:normal; margin-left: 1.5em; display:block; margin-bottom: 8px; border-bottom: 1px solid silver;}
div.labBezeichnung {color: #222222; font-weight:bolder; margin-left: 0.5em; display:block; margin-bottom: 8px; border-bottom: 1px solid silver;}

div.nachoben {text-align:right;}

.labListBody {margin-top: 0px; margin-bottom: 30px;}
.labListItemHead .bezeichnung{background-color: #FFCC59; margin:0; padding-left: 10px; color: #222222;  display:block; width: 100%;}
.lub_name {font-weight: bolder;}
.labListItemBody {margin-top:20px;}

div.labAddressDescription img {vertical-align: text-bottom;}
div.labAddressDescription {margin: 5px; padding-left: 1.5em; margin-top: 1.5em;}
div.labAddressDescription img {margin: 5px; margin-left: 1.5em;}
div.labAddressPerson {margin: 5px; padding-left: 1.5em;}
div.labAddressContact {margin: 5px; padding-left: 1.5em;}
ul.ZirisCityNav {
	padding: 0;
    margin: 0;    
    display: inline;
}

ul.ZirisCityNav li {
	display: inline;
	margin: 3px;
}

.ZirisCityNavLink {
	/*border: 1px solid Silver;
	white-space: pre;*/
}

.ZirisCityNavLink {
	/*border: 1px solid Silver;
	white-space: pre;*/
}

#lub_ortsregister {
	/*border: 1px solid Silver;*/
	font-weight: bold;
	/*overflow: auto;*/
}

.h3 {font-size:1.1em; color:#765; background:transparent; font-weight: bolder;}

/* #############################
** ### Datei-Links #############
** #############################
*/
table.csc-uploads {width: 100%}


/*### Sehenswertes ###############
*/

div.labContent {margin: 10px;}
#ziris_header_top {}
#ziris_header_headline{float:left;}
#OrganizationalUnit {margin-top:10px;}
#OrganizationalUnit img {margin-left:10px;}
.OrganizationalUnit {width: 580px;}
#ziris_inhalt_header_top, #ziris_inhalt_address {margin-left: 0px;}
.ziris_language {padding-left:5px; float:left; line-height:24px;  border-bottom: 2px solid #708090; height: 26px; }
.ziris_language span#uk img {vertical-align: middle;}
#ziris_inhalt_body {margin: 0px; margin-top: 10px; margin-right: 0px;}
#ziris_inhalt_body table img {padding-left: 10px; padding-bottom: 5px;}
#ziris_inhalt_body img {padding-left: 15px; padding-bottom: 15px;}
.ziris_anreise_objekt {margin-right: 0px;}
.info {background:#f7f7ef url(http://static.lookundbook.de/img/icons/ausrufez-blau.gif) 10px 10px no-repeat; padding:1.5em 1.5em 1.5em 4em;}
p.info {background:#f7f7ef url(http://static.lookundbook.de/img/icons/ausrufez-blau.gif) 10px 10px no-repeat; padding:1.5em 1.5em 1.5em 4em;}
.frage {background:#A43F15 url(http://static.lookundbook.de/img/icons/fragez-blau.gif) 10px 10px no-repeat; color:#fff; padding:1.5em 1.5em 1.5em 4em;}
.stop {background:#fff url(http://static.lookundbook.de/img/icons/stop.gif) 10px 10px no-repeat; padding:1.5em 1.5em 1.5em 4em; border:1px solid #a43f15;}
p.zitat {background:#fff url(http://static.lookundbook.de/img/icons/sprechblase.gif) 10px 10px no-repeat; color:#187ba2; padding:1.5em 1.5em 1.5em 4em; border:1px solid #187ba2; font-style:italic;}
.zitat {background:#fff url(http://static.lookundbook.de/img/icons/sprechblase.gif) 10px 10px no-repeat; color:#187ba2; padding:1.5em 1.5em 1.5em 4em; border:1px solid #187ba2; font-style:italic;}

.labContent h2 {margin-left: 0px; margin-right: 0px; margin-top: 20px;}

.lab_inhalt {margin-left: 0px; margin-right: 0px; margin-top: 20px; text-align: justify;}
.lab_inhalt_body {margin-left: 0px; margin-right: 0px; margin-top: 10px;}
.lab_inhalt_body img {margin-left: 10px; margin-bottom: 10px;}
.lab_branchen {margin-left: 10px; margin-right: 30px; margin-top: 15px;}
.lab_orte, .buchen, .lab_information {margin-left: 10px; margin-right: 30px; margin-top: 15px;}
.labBacklink {margin-right: 30px; margin-top: 5px;}
.legende_right, .legende_left {line-height: 25px;}
.legende_right img, .legende_left img {vertical-align: middle; margin-right: 10px;}


/*### Events ###############
*/

#ziris_kontainer { margin: 10px;}
.event_date {margin-top: 20px; font-weight: bolder;}
.event_beschreibung {margin: 10px;}
}


